## Configuration

Welcome to Dripwise! Config lives in a single env file at the repo root — no YAML, no surprises. The basics: GREENHOUSE_NAME is just a display label, WATER_INTERVAL_HOURS sets how often the scheduler wakes up (default 6), and MOISTURE_THRESHOLD is the percent below which we actually water. Set DRY_RUN=1 while you're learning so you don't flood anyone's ferns. Last bit: the scheduler talks to the valve hub over an authenticated channel, and that credential goes on the very next line.

vault entry, yahif-yajep: COURIER_KEY29=b802bdf8034096b65a51c6ba5abe2

## Further reading

Undo/redo in Sketchforge uses a command stack, not snapshots. Every mutation implements `apply` and `invert`; the Rewind module replays them. Never mutate the model outside a command or history breaks silently. Batch operations wrap child commands in a composite. Design rationale and known pitfalls are documented on the internal page below.

operations page: https://jira.qorvelsys.internal/browse/pages/browse/pages

### Step 4: Point the CSV Import Wizard at the new store

Welcome aboard! This step moves the Ledgerpine import wizard off the old flat-file backend. First, make sure steps 1–3 finished cleanly — the wizard will happily import into the wrong place if the store path is stale. Then update the wizard's settings file and restart the worker. Column mappings carry over automatically, so don't re-create those. If a dry-run import succeeds, you're done with this step. The settings you should end up with are below.

service settings:
PRAIX_LOG_LEVEL=error
PRAIX_METRICS_HOST=metrics.praix.qorvelcorp.corp
PRAIX_POOL_SIZE=16